How do you detect a brain aneurysm? An MRI uses a magnetic field and radio waves to create detailed images of the brain, either 2-D slices or 3-D images. A type of MRI that assesses the arteries in detail ( MRI angiography) may detect the presence of an aneurysm.
Does dementia show up on brain MRI? In Radiology, patients pose this question often. “Can MRI show if I have dementia?” In fact, we scan patients every day with a diagnosis of dementia, memory loss, Alzheimer’s, and confusion, among a variety of other neurological disorders. The truth is that MRI is NOT the test to formally diagnose dementia.
How accurate is MRI for Alzheimer’s? They observed that there was a significant difference between the rate of change in patients with Alzheimer disease and the rate in control subjects. With MRI, sensitivity and specificity were approximately 90% for predicting the decline in dementia.

What test will detect liver cancer?
The CT scan is an x-ray test that makes detailed images of your body. A CT scan of the abdomen can help find many types of liver tumors. It can give specific information about the size, shape, and location of any tumors in the liver or elsewhere in the abdomen, as well as nearby blood vessels.

What will liver ultrasound show?
A liver scan may be done to check for diseases such as liver cancer , hepatitis , or cirrhosis . Lesions such as tumors, abscesses, or cysts of the liver or spleen may be seen on a liver scan.

What is it called when you can’t recognize facial expressions?
Prosopagnosia, also known as face blindness, means you cannot recognise people’s faces. Face blindness often affects people from birth and is usually a problem a person has for most or all of their life. It can have a severe impact on everyday life.

How do you know if your baby has neuroblastoma?
Tumors in the abdomen (belly) or pelvis: One of the most common signs of a neuroblastoma is a large lump or swelling in the child’s abdomen. The child might not want to eat (which can lead to weight loss). If the child is old enough, they may complain of feeling full or having belly pain.

Does HIV affect Haemoglobin levels?
Anemia (hemoglobin < 10 g/dL) and severe anemia (hemoglobin< 7.5 g/dL) [1] are common among people living with HIV (PLWH) [2], and the prevalence of anemia increases with HIV disease severity [3, 4].
What can be detected with an amniocentesis?
Amniocentesis detects chromosome abnormalities, neural tube defects, and genetic disorders. Down syndrome or Trisomy 21 is the most common chromosome abnormality. Genetic disorders include disorders such as cystic fibrosis. The most common neural tube defect is spina bifida.
